The Evolution of Meme Coins: From Obscurity to Mainstream Craze
Meme coins have undergone a remarkable transformation in recent years, evolving from obscure digital assets to a mainstream craze that has captured the attention of investors around the world. These coins, which are based on popular internet memes and often have no real-world utility, have seen their popularity skyrocket as retail investors seek out new and exciting opportunities in the cryptocurrency market.
What started as a niche fascination among a small group of enthusiasts has now grown into a global phenomenon, with meme coins generating significant buzz on social media platforms and attracting a flood of new investors looking to get in on the action. The rise of meme coins can be attributed to a combination of factors, including their low barrier to entry, viral marketing potential, and the sense of community that often surrounds them.
As meme coins have gained traction, they have also faced their fair share of criticism and skepticism from traditional investors and regulators. Critics argue that meme coins are purely speculative assets with little intrinsic value, and warn that investors could be at risk of losing their money if the market takes a downturn. Despite these concerns, meme coins continue to attract a devoted following, with new projects launching regularly and existing coins seeing dramatic price fluctuations.
The Meteoric Rise of Dogecoin and Shiba Inu: A Retrospective
In the past year, Dogecoin and Shiba Inu experienced a meteoric rise in popularity and value, capturing the attention of investors and cryptocurrency enthusiasts alike. These meme coins, initially created as a joke, gained traction due to their strong online communities and viral marketing campaigns. The sudden surge in demand for Dogecoin and Shiba Inu led to a significant increase in their prices, making early adopters and investors substantial profits.
The rise of Dogecoin and Shiba Inu also highlighted the power of social media and online forums in driving the success of meme coins. Reddit, Twitter, and other platforms became hotbeds of discussions and memes about these digital assets, further fueling their popularity. The sense of community and shared enthusiasm among supporters of Dogecoin and Shiba Inu helped create a self-reinforcing cycle of hype and investment.
As Dogecoin and Shiba Inu continued to climb in value, they attracted mainstream media attention, drawing in even more investors looking to capitalize on the trend. Celebrities and influencers began endorsing these meme coins, further amplifying their reach and appeal. The frenzy surrounding Dogecoin and Shiba Inu reached a fever pitch, with their prices skyrocketing to unprecedented levels.
However, the rapid ascent of Dogecoin and Shiba Inu also raised concerns about the sustainability of their growth. Critics pointed to the lack of intrinsic value and utility of these meme coins, warning of a potential bubble that could burst at any moment. As quickly as they rose, Dogecoin and Shiba Inu experienced a sharp decline in value, leaving many investors with significant losses.
Looking back, the meteoric rise of Dogecoin and Shiba Inu serves as a cautionary tale about the volatile nature of meme coins and the risks associated with investing in speculative assets. While they captured the imagination of the public and generated immense excitement, their fall from grace underscores the importance of due diligence and risk management in the world of cryptocurrency. As the hype around meme coins fades, investors are left to reflect on the lessons learned from this wild ride in the digital asset market.

The Role of Social Media Influencers in the Meme Coin Market
Social media influencers play a crucial role in the meme coin market, influencing the buying and selling behaviors of their followers. These influencers have a significant impact on the popularity and value of meme coins through their posts, videos, and endorsements. By leveraging their large and engaged audiences, influencers can create hype around a particular meme coin, causing its value to skyrocket in a short period of time.
Many meme coins rely on influencers to promote their projects and attract new investors. These influencers often receive compensation in the form of tokens or money for promoting a meme coin to their followers. This can lead to a surge in interest in the coin, as people trust the influencers’ recommendations and jump on the bandwagon to invest.
However, the influence of social media influencers in the meme coin market can also have negative consequences. If an influencer promotes a meme coin that turns out to be a scam or fails to deliver on its promises, it can lead to significant financial losses for investors. This highlights the importance of conducting thorough research and due diligence before investing in any meme coin based on an influencer’s recommendation.
NFT Integration: The Future of Meme Coins?
One potential solution to the volatility and lack of utility of meme coins is the integration of non-fungible tokens (NFTs). By combining meme coins with NFT technology, developers can create unique digital assets that have inherent value beyond just being a speculative investment.
Unlike traditional cryptocurrencies, NFTs are one-of-a-kind digital assets that are indivisible and cannot be replicated. This uniqueness makes them ideal for adding value to meme coins, as each coin can represent a specific NFT that holds sentimental or collectible value.
Integrating NFTs into meme coins could provide a new level of authenticity and scarcity, making them more attractive to investors and collectors alike. This could help stabilize the value of meme coins and give them a use case beyond just being a meme.
Furthermore, the integration of NFTs could open up new opportunities for meme coins to be used in decentralized applications (dApps) and online marketplaces. This could create a new ecosystem around meme coins, where users can buy, sell, and trade unique digital assets in a secure and transparent manner.
Overall, the integration of NFTs could be the key to the future success of meme coins, providing them with a level of utility and value that goes beyond just being a passing trend. By combining the unique properties of NFTs with the viral nature of meme coins, developers could create a new breed of digital assets that capture the imagination of users around the world.
